Google releases Chrome beta for Android ICS
It is now available in Beta in select countries and languages for phones and tablets with Android ICS.

New Delhi: Google has finally introduced the first ever version of Chrome for Android. However, the browser (a beta) is currently available only for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ich phone or tablet. In other words, a beta version of Google's desktop browser can be installed on any device that runs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ich.

"Like the desktop version, Chrome for Android Beta is focused on speed and simplicity, but it also features seamless sign-in and sync so you can take your personalised web browsing experience with you wherever you go, across devices," said Google in a blog post.

Chrome for Android is said to be designed from the ground up for mobile devices. The comapny said, we reimagined tabs so they fit just as naturally on a small-screen phone as they do on a larger screen tablet. You can flip or swipe between an unlimited number of tabs using intuitive gestures.

It is now available in Beta from Android Market, in select countries and languages for phones and tablets with Android 4.0, Ice Cream Sandwich.
